Presenting three tracks from Bandini's debut album "Barflies". Inspired by the story of a night out in the effervescent streets of London, the songs offer a taste of the get up and dance, the wonders of weirdness and the beauty of a ballad, lovingly descending you through the experience and intricacies one night in London can cause.
Genre
Aspects of jazz, blues, rock, pop and gypsy.
Similar to
Tom Waits, Cab Calloway, Dr John and The Neville Brothers, Screamin' Jay Hawkins.
